UFLI?

Hi everyone,

I tried to google around in order to learn how ufli works but could not find anything. I know how fli, afli, shfli, shifli and finally xfli works.

can someone please explain how ufli works and what are its limitations. i tried to look at the displayer code of that veronica picture. i see sprites involved. but i do not understand the code...

x-expandend sprite layer, 7 sprites, priority "behind" bitmap, fli every second line.
